A deck festooned with paper lanterns overlooks the waterfront at Three Tides (2 Pinchy Ln., Belfast, 207/338-1707, www.3tides.com [1], 4 p.m.–close Tue.–Sat.; 4 p.m.–9 p.m. Sun., $7–11), a tin-and-wood-beam shack that has been transformed into a hipster tapas bar. Teens and twentysomethings from around the area come here nightly to listen to jam bands and nosh on quesadillas and Pemaquid [2] oysters.
